Title: First Day of School
Description: Students throughout Fort Worth, Texas, are preparing for the opening day of the 1945-1946 school year. Principal Elden B. Busby, of Arlington Heights High School, is conferring with a group of new students entering the high school. Principal Busby is shown seated at his desk. The students, left to right, are Dean Hatch, Jim Cornish, Conrad Johnson, and Gene Fensky. Mr. Hatch, of Azle, Texas, is wearing a button-up shirt and trousers. Mr. Cornish, of Houston, Texas, is dressed in a plaid shirt and trousers. Mr. Johnson, of San Antonio, Texas, is wearing a short-sleeve button-up shirt and trousers. Mr. Fensky, of Compton, California, is sitting next to the principal, dressed in a t-shirt.
